Hospital Trusts productivity in the English NHS: Uncovering possible drivers of productivity variations.

María Jose Aragon AragonAdriana CastelliJames Gaughan
Published in: PloS one (2017)
We find that larger Trusts and Foundation Trusts are associated with lower productivity, as are those treating a greater proportion of both older and/or younger patients. Surprisingly treating more patients in their last year of life is associated with higher Labour Productivity.
